The Story So Far: Setting the Stage for Revelations
Before diving into the DLC's narrative, it is crucial to understand the foundation laid by the base game. DOOM: The Dark Ages took players back in time, serving as a prequel that explored the Doom Slayer’s time with the Night Sentinels. The setting shifted from futuristic Mars facilities to a brutal, medieval dark fantasy world where the Slayer wielded a skull-crushing flail and a revving shield saw.
The Revelations DLC picks up exactly where the base campaign left off. The war against the demonic hordes of Hell has reached a boiling point, and the Slayer is forced to uncover ancient truths about his allies and enemies. Community reports indicate that the narrative tone shifts from pure conquest to mystery and betrayal, making the cinematic cutscenes more crucial than ever.

Lore Implications: What We Learn About the Slayer
For lore enthusiasts, the Doom The Dark Ages Revelations DLC full game movie is an absolute goldmine. The narrative pulls back the curtain on the Divinity Machine and the true cost of the Slayer's immense power. We finally see the political machinations of Argent D'Nur before its tragic fall.
One of the most praised aspects of the DLC's story is how it recontextualizes the enemies we fight in later games. The cutscenes reveal that some of the most grotesque demons were once noble warriors, twisted by dark magic. This tragic element adds emotional weight to the Slayer's endless crusade.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
What exactly is a Doom The Dark Ages Revelations DLC full game movie? A Doom The Dark Ages Revelations DLC full game movie is a fan-made video compilation that edits together all the cutscenes, important dialogue, and key story moments from the DLC into a single, seamless, movie-like experience, usually without player commentary.
Is the story in the Revelations DLC canon? Yes, the events depicted in the Revelations DLC are official canon. They serve as a crucial bridge in the timeline, detailing the Slayer's history with the Night Sentinels and setting up the events of the modern DOOM games.
Why is the DLC age-restricted on platforms like Steam? According to the developers, the DLC contains "Blood and Gore, Intense Violence." The cinematic cutscenes feature brutal executions and dark, mature themes that are not appropriate for all ages, requiring an age-gate for viewing and purchasing.
Do I need to play the base game to understand the DLC movie? While the DLC movie can be enjoyed as a dark fantasy action film on its own, watching or playing the base game's story first is highly recommended. It provides necessary context regarding the Night Sentinels and the Slayer's role in the medieval war against Hell.
